(如图)商品搜索功能发送的http中的listType参数是怎么来的

先看前端接口:
产品搜索 /manage/product/search.do(可以按商品id查询或按商品名称查询)
request:
    productName
    productId
    pageNum(default=1)  (分页功能定义的页数,如第五页:pageNum=5)
    pageSize(default=10) (每页容量)


疑问:

当点击后台商品搜索功能的<按商品名称查询>时,打开浏览器的开发者工具的Network,
发现传递的http是类似这样的:
taobao.com/manage/product/search.do?listType=search&pageNum=1&productName=Java

   1.请问链接中的listType参数是怎么来的?
   2.productSearch()方法中要求传递过来的参数是四个:productName,productId,
   pageNum,pageSize,但是传递过来的参数貌似是三个,而且还不对应,这是为什么?
   可能是有些知识点模糊了。

图片描述

阅读 1.9k
1 个回答

1.多的参数可能是前台自己拼接的
2.如果前台传了四个,后台肯定四个,看你的方法应该是没获取.
3.key value要是对不上,可能前台传错了吧....

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题